Frequently Asked Questions

Are there easy waterfall trails near Pisogne suitable for families?

Yes, the Valle di Inzino offers a very beautiful and pleasant walk, suitable even for inexperienced hikers and families. Additionally, the Love Waterfall (Cascata dell'Amore) in Sulzano is an easy, approximately one-hour stroll that is also family-friendly.

What are some unique waterfalls to visit near Pisogne?

You can discover the Whale Waterfall, which features a unique art installation of two whale tails at its base. Another interesting spot is the Friars' Waterfall, named after a nearby convent, where an artist has also created works, including whale tails.

What is the best time of year to visit the waterfalls around Pisogne?

The waterfalls are generally best visited after periods of rain, especially in spring or autumn, when water flow is typically stronger. For a pleasant walk and to cool off, the warmer months are suitable, particularly for spots like Valle di Inzino.

Are there any adventurous waterfall trails in the area?

Yes, the Waterfall Trail in Monticelli Brusati offers a more adventurous experience. This ring-shaped nature trail in the Valley of Gaina features a small canyon, equipped sections with ropes, and steps carved into the rock, providing an exciting exploration of the natural landscape.

Can I find waterfalls directly accessible from the road near Pisogne?

Yes, the Zu Waterfall is conveniently located right next to the provincial road along Lake Iseo, near Riva di Solto. It offers an easily accessible viewpoint directly from the road.

What kind of terrain can I expect on waterfall trails around Pisogne?

The terrain varies. For example, the path to Bagnadore Stream Waterfall is unpaved and includes downhill and uphill sections, making sturdy shoes advisable. Other trails, like the Waterfall Trail in Monticelli Brusati, can include asphalt, dirt tracks, and equipped sections with ropes and carved steps.

Are there other outdoor activities I can combine with a waterfall visit near Pisogne?

Absolutely. The region around Pisogne offers various outdoor activities. You can explore mountain hikes, enjoy cycling routes, or try gravel biking. Many of these routes pass through scenic areas, allowing you to combine your waterfall visit with a longer adventure.

What do visitors enjoy most about the waterfalls around Pisogne?

Visitors appreciate the natural beauty and the peaceful atmosphere. Many enjoy the opportunity to cool off in traditional mountain streams, the scenic views of extraordinary stone formations, and the pleasant walks. The unique art installations at some waterfalls also add a surprising element to the experience.

Are the waterfall trails around Pisogne dog-friendly?

Many trails in the area are suitable for dogs. For instance, the short hike to Bagnadore Stream Waterfall has been enjoyed by visitors with their dogs. Always ensure your dog is on a leash and that you clean up after them to preserve the natural environment.

Where can I find waterfalls that offer great views?

The Bagnadore Stream Waterfall is part of a circular route that provides beautiful views of extraordinary stone formations. The Zu Waterfall also offers a viewpoint directly from the provincial road along Lake Iseo.

Are there any historical or cultural points of interest near the waterfalls?

Near the Love Waterfall in Sulzano, you can visit the Church of San Fermo, which offers splendid views of Lake Iseo. The Waterfall Trail in Monticelli Brusati also features old dry-stone walls and lime kilns, providing a glimpse into the region's past.

Is parking available near the waterfall trails?

Specific parking information varies by location. For the Love Waterfall, the path begins in Via Tassano, Sulzano, where you may find local parking options. For the Waterfall Trail, the route starts from the hamlet of Gaina, where parking might be available. It's advisable to check local signage upon arrival.
